← Back to all MPs
Official portrait of The Rt Hon. the Lord McFall of Alcluith

The Rt Hon. the Lord McFall of Alcluith

Crossbench Life peer M
Lord McFall of Alcluith's full title is The Rt Hon. the Lord McFall of Alcluith. His name is John Francis McFall, and he is a current member of the House of Lords.

Pay & earnings · 2026

MP base salary £0 / £93,904 annual
0 days served — year-to-date · annual rate £93,904
Committee chair additional salary £3,410
House of Lords Commission · 34 days £1,705
Restoration and Renewal Client Board · 34 days £1,705
Declared outside earnings £0
0 registered interests published in 2026
Total (salary + chair + declared) £3,410
Base salary: House of Commons Library SN02644 / IPSA. Earnings from Register of Interests (API), published during 2026.

Constituencies represented

2005-05-052010-05-06
West Dunbartonshire
1997-05-012005-05-05
Dumbarton
1987-06-111997-05-01
Dumbarton

Party history

2026-02-02present
Crossbench current
2021-05-012026-02-01
Lord Speaker
2016-09-012021-04-30
Non-affiliated
1987-06-112016-08-31
Labour

Government posts

1998-07-281999-12-02
Parliamentary Under-Secretary (Northern Ireland Office)
1997-05-081998-07-28
Lord Commissioner (HM Treasury) (Whip)

Opposition posts

None recorded.

Committee memberships

1988-04-281992-03-16
Defence Committee
1992-04-271992-10-26
Transport Committee
2000-03-032001-03-05
Public Administration Committee
2001-07-162010-05-06
Treasury Committee Chair
2001-11-052010-05-06
Liaison Committee (Commons)
2011-07-202011-12-13
Draft Financial Services Bill (Joint Committee)
2012-05-162015-03-30
Economic Affairs Committee
2012-07-172013-06-12
Parliamentary Commission on Banking Standards (Joint Committee)
2015-06-122016-08-31
EU Financial Affairs Sub-Committee
2016-05-252016-08-31
European Union Committee
2016-09-012021-04-29
Hybrid Instruments Committee (Lords) Chair +£15,025/yr
2016-09-012021-04-29
Committee of Selection (Lords) Chair +£15,025/yr
2016-09-012021-04-29
Standing Orders (Private Bills) Committee (Lords) Chair +£15,025/yr
2016-09-012021-04-29
Liaison Committee (Lords) Chair +£15,025/yr
2016-09-012019-05-09
Committee for Privileges and Conduct (Lords) Chair +£15,025/yr
2016-09-012021-04-29
Procedure and Privileges Committee Chair +£15,025/yr
2016-09-012021-04-30
Sub-Committee on Leave of Absence Chair +£15,025/yr
2021-05-132026-02-03
House of Lords Commission Chair +£15,928/yr
2016-09-012026-02-03
House of Lords Commission
2020-09-232021-07-14
Parliamentary Works Estimates Commission
2024-07-222026-02-03
Restoration and Renewal Client Board Chair +£17,806/yr
2022-10-172024-05-30
Restoration and Renewal Client Board Chair +£16,422/yr
Chair additional salary only applies to specified select committees under Standing Order 122B. Regular members receive no additional pay.

Contact

Parliamentary office
contactholmember@parliament.uk
020 7219 5353 · House of Lords, London, SW1A 0PW

APPGs (2026) · 0 active officership(s)

No APPG officerships found for this MP. (Officer matching is by name — if the parliamentary register lists them under a slightly different form, the join may miss; check /appgs directly.)

Commons votes · 2026

No Commons votes recorded for 2026.

Written parliamentary questions · 2026

No written questions tabled in 2026.

Bills sponsored & supported · 2026

0 bills 0 as lead sponsor 0 as supporter
No bills sponsored or supported in 2026.
Source: UK Parliament Bills API. "Lead" sponsor is the primary mover (sortOrder = 1); "Supporter" rows are MPs who backed the bill at introduction. Year is the bill's first-reading date.

Historic bills (all-time)

0 bills 0 as lead sponsor 0 as supporter
No bills sponsored or supported on record.
Same source as the year-scoped panel above, but unconstrained by year. The "Sponsored" tag = lead sponsor; "Supported" = backed at introduction. Sorted newest first.
Loading… this can take up to a minute.